Transaction 64f0aea869ae3fc8538edb95e69fe69234305b73fa31651d60f88b10785acb42

4 Input
2 Outputs
  • 64f0aea869ae3fc8538edb95e69fe69234305b73fa31651d60f88b10785acb42:0
  • value  66168
    address  168WuUJnQkDKpgdMhRNjk4wfaYRJscKmcL
  • 64f0aea869ae3fc8538edb95e69fe69234305b73fa31651d60f88b10785acb42:1
  • value  500000
    address  3NxQx1ZwzagUkRbFAQBKKrZp8chmh559Jb